Perl programming books pdf

Free perl books it, programming and computer science. Ebooks are in various format, either pdf or browsable online html books. Programming download free lectures notes, papers and ebooks related to programming, computer science, web design, mobile app development, software engineering, networking, databases, information technology and many more. From wikibooks, open books for an open world jump to navigation jump to search raku is a successor of the perl programming language, representing a major backwardsincompatible rewrite of the language. Feel free to read online or download it right from the source. If youre on a microsoft system, youll probably prefer the learning perl on win32 systems version.

Its an approach to writing great software with the perl programming language. Perl is an open source software, licensed under its artistic license, or the gnu general. Perl 5 tutorial, first edition chan bernard ki hong. Its for readers who have dabbled a little in perl and want a single reference for all their needs. Teach yourself perl 5 in 21 days teknik sipil unila. Isbn 9780596004927 4 th edition february 2012 isbn 9781449398903 ebook. It omits specialized books like those on web apps and parsing.

Cgi programming with perl, second edition, offers a comprehensive explanation of using cgi to serve dynamic web content. This document should also find use as a handy desk reference for some of the more common perl related questions. Reflecting years of classroom testing and experience, this edition is packed with exercises that let you practice the concepts while you follow the text. Though perl is not officially an acronym but few people used it. Running modern perl the modernperl module from the cpan the cpan, pp. Complete guide for senior women to ketogenic diet and a healthy weight loss, including a 28day meal plan and over 100 mouthwatering recipes. Download pdf perl cgi programming free online new books. How to think like a computer scientist is an introduction to computer science and programming intended for people with little or no experience. Cgi programming with perl, 2nd edition oreilly media. Its written particularly with the beginning programmer in mind, but experienced programmers will not feel patronised. Cost and licensing installing perl installed getting and installing perl writing perl programs creating the program invocation comments in your program. With free online books, over 25,000 extension modules, and a large developer community, there are many ways to learn perl. Getting started with perl language, comments, variables, interpolation in perl, true and false, dates and time, control statements, subroutines, debug output, lists, sorting, file io reading and writing files, reading a files content into a variable and strings and quoting methods. You can find a list of perl 6 books here, as well as guidance on which one to read.

It really is a poor choice for a beginners starter language, so know what youre getting in to. Discover the best perl programming in best sellers. Most or all of the software on cpan is also available under either the artistic license, the gpl, or both. It also enables new features introduced in modern perl releases. This book had its genesis in two chapters of the first edition of programming perl. Though perl is not officially an acronym but few people used it as practical extraction and report language. This book promotes the use of perl as a programming language, encouraging the creation of legible and sensible programs so as to dispel the image of perl as. According to its creator, perl is the practical extraction and report language, or the pathologically eclectic rubbish lister. Free perl books download ebooks online textbooks tutorials. Its how effective perl programmers write powerful, maintainable, scalable, concise, and excellent code. Covers extreme programming an approach to software development that emphasizes business results and involves rapid iteration, code writing and continuous testing, release planning, iteration planning, pair programming, tracking, acceptance testing, coding style, logistics, testdriven design, continuous design, unit testing, refactoring and smop. Introduction to perl, numeric and string literals, variables, arrays, operators, perl statements, functions, references, files input and output in perl, regular expressions, special variables, handling errors and signals, objects in perl, perl modules, debugging perl, networking with perl. Since then, perl has grown with the times, and so has this book. This aim of this book is not primarily to teach perl 6, but instead to teach the art of programming, using the perl 6 language.

Perl 6 is the newest member of the family of languages known as perl. Perl is a stable, cross platform programming language. If you want a solid intro to perl programming think perl 6 is the best option for beginners. Raku programming wikibooks, open books for an open world. Perl is a wellestablished programming language that has been developed through the time and effort of countless free software programmers into an immensely powerful tool that can be used on pratically every operating system in the world. Perl programmingcpan wikibooks, open books for an open world. Click download or read online button to perl cgi programming book pdf for free now. A huge collection of freely usable perl modules, ranging from advanced mathematics to database connectivity, networking and more, can be downloaded from a network of sites called cpan. Here is a list of books that can teach you perl with some remarks on each book. Perl is a wellestablished programming language that has been developed through the time and effort of countless free software programmers into. Writing web pages in perl using perl as an objectoriented language book overview perl is a wellestablished programming language that has been developed through the time and effort of countless free software programmers into an immensely powerful tool that can be used on pratically every operating system in the world. Having a copy of programming perl handy will allow you to look up the exact definition of an operator, keyword, or function. Perl book perl by example pdf perl perl by example perl tk intermediate perl learning perl programming perl perl beginners learning perl tk beginning perl o reilly perl 6 programming in perl perl tutorial mastering perl tk pdf perl language mastering perl tk mastering perl perl cookbook perl cockbook perl by example pdf perl perl.

While every precaution has been taken in the preparation of this book, the publisher assumes. This note provides a detailed explanation of the following topics in perl. It primarily focuses on fundamental perl programming. Python notes for professionals book free programming books. Unless otherwise mentioned, all of the code snippets in this book assume youve started with this basic program skeleton.

This book isnt meant to be a complete reference book for perl, although we do describe some parts of perl previously undocumented. One in particular has gained a lot of popularity over the past five or ten years its called objectoriented programming, or oop for short. The type of programming weve been doing so far has been based around tasks. As this is not a printed book, i will constantly add new materials to this tutorial as. A tutorial book, covering how you could spend the first 30 to 40 hours with perl. I speak from first hand experience, i first learned to code with perl, completely self taught. Beginning perl impatient perl html or pdf extreme perl html, pdf or a4 pdf macperl. Its the newest book on this topic covering the latest advancements in perl, but it also teaches the fundamentals along with practical modernday uses for perl scripting. The following flow chart should help you to decide which generalpurpose book to approach first.

Just like the basic programming language, the name perl isnt really an acronym. Perl started out as the swiss army knife of computer. Here seven free perl ebook that is presented by library. A book by chromatic, a wellknown perl programmer, writer, and author, about how to write perl 5 in a good and modern way. Find the top 100 most popular items in amazon books best sellers. The first edition of this book, programming perl, hit the shelves in 1990, and was quickly adopted as the undisputed bible of the language. It covers a lot of ground, from the very basics of programming, right through to developing cgi applications for the web. People like making up acronyms though and larry has two favorite expansions. Free pdf download using perl 6 free computer books. Neither a reference book nor a tutorial book, the perl cookbook serves as a companion book to both. This book is for perl programmers who need to get things done. Thats what learning perl, a kinder and gentler introduction to perl, is designed for. Perl is a powerful programming language that has grown in popularity since it first appeared in 1988. Marshall 1999 html perl notes contents introduction to perl what is perl.

It is used for mission critical projects in the public and private sectors. The major reference book on perl, written by the creator of perl, is programming perl. Perl is a generalpurpose programming language originally developed for text manipulation and now used for a wide range of tasks including system administration, web development, network programming, gui development, and more. Teach yourself perl 5 in 21 days david till table of contents. Objectoriented perl as weve mentioned before, there are several schools of thought in programming. Perl cgi programming download perl cgi programming ebook pdf or read online books in pdf, epub, and mobi format.

If you found this free python book useful, then please share it getting started with python language. Besides context, perl has default variablesthe programming equivalent of pronouns. Covers from the basics up to doing objectoriented programming using moose, and a bit beyond. Perl is an immensely popular scripting language that combines the best features of c, key unix utilities and a powerful use of regular expressions. It embraces several paradigms like procedural, object oriented, and functional programming, and offers powerful tools for parsing text. Perl notes for professionals book free programming books. If youre looking for a free download links of java programming language pdf, epub, docx and torrent then this site is not for you. Perl has an active world wide community with over 300 local groups, mailing lists and supportdiscussion websites. Based on the bestselling cgi programming on the world wide web, this edition has been completely rewritten to demonstrate current techniques available with the cgi.

65 20 40 118 1228 629 279 1221 856 1169 765 514 1539 490 369 465 1219 1410 111 665 141 112 692 1272 1496 1258 51 310 1306 1200 1459 1175 947 1376 169 1331 1025